How to conjugate desviar in Indicative Imperfect in Spanish

desviar
to divert, to deflect, to stray
regular verb

Desviar means to turn aside, divert, or cause something to change direction. It can be used physically, such as diverting a road, or metaphorically, such as diverting attention.

How to conjugate desviar in Indicative Imperfect

El Pretérito Imperfecto - used to describe regular and repeated actions that happened in the past

Indicative Imperfect Conjugations

PronounConjugation
Yo
desviaba
desviabas
Él / Ella / Usted
desviaba
Nosotros / Nosotras
desviábamos
Vosotros / Vosotras
desviabais
Ellos / Ellas / Ustedes
desviaban

Examples of desviar in Indicative Imperfect

Yo
Yo desviaba la mirada cuando me hablaban.
I used to avert my gaze when they spoke to me.
Tú desviabas la atención en clase.
You used to distract attention in class.
Él / Ella / Usted
Ella desviaba el camino para evitar obstáculos.
She used to divert the path to avoid obstacles.
Nosotros / Nosotras
Nosotros desviábamos la ruta habitual.
We used to deviate from the usual route.
Vosotros / Vosotras
Vosotros desviabais la atención del problema.
You all used to divert attention from the problem.
Ellos / Ellas / Ustedes
Ellos desviaban la mirada cuando mentían.
They used to avert their gaze when they lied.
